1. 데이터 베이스 관리자가 기본테이블에서 임의로 유도하여 만드는 테이블
2. 사용자에게 접근이 허용된 자료만 보여줌
3. 장점
- 논리적 데이터 독립성 제공
- 접근 제어를 통해 보안
- 사용자 데이터 관리를 간단히
* 기본테이블에서 유도된 가상 테이블, 간단하게 생성, 삭제 하지만 변경이 불가능하여 다시 설치 해야함
4. 기본 테이블은 물리적으로 구성되어 데이터가 실제로 저장되지만 뷰는 물리적이지 않다
5. 하나이 상의 기본 테이블로 유도된 가상 테이블
6. Drop : 제거 , Create : 생성 , 검색 : Select
7. 뷰를 이용해 또 다른 뷰의 생성이 가능
8. 삽입, 갱신, 삭제 연산에는 제약
9. View1 을 이용하여 View2 생성후 테이블 R 과 View2 를 조인하여 View3 를 생성하였다
그 후 Drop View V1 Restrict 명령어 실행 하면 View1 이 삭제 되지 않는다.
10. 뷰의 정의는 Alter 문을 이용해 변경할수 없다
댓글 없음:
댓글 쓰기